There are different counting function in MS Excel , like count(), counta(), countblank(), countif()
count(range)
count function counts the numeric cells in given data range, means count function will return total numbers of cells which contain numbers in given data range, like if have entered salaries in a column but in some cells you have not entered numbers or left empty. Now you want ot count the cells which contains the salary amounts then you can use count function, lets assume if you have entered the salaries of employees from cell f4 to f20 , now you can type count function in any cell as =count(f4:f20)
counta(range)
This function counts all cells , excel blank cell, meaning you can count all cells in which you have entered some data in some column. Assume we have some data entered in column g, from cell g4 to g30, now we can use counta() formula to count the cells which contains some value as =counta(g4:g30)
countblank(range)
This function counts empty cells in given data range, like if you have entered some data in column f , from range f5 to f30, but in that range some cells are empty, then you can use this formula to count the empty cells like =countblank(f5:f30)
countif(range,condition)
If you want to count cells in a range according to some condition, like you have entered names of persons in a column and want to see how much times a particular name is entered into column, suppose you have entered Ali 3 time in a rage of cell from b4 to b20, then if you type function =countif(b4:b20,"Ali") in any cell it will return 3.
